    How I think the Bills make the playoffs!

    I believe that controlling your own destiny is always the best way but I think the Bills have a shot with some help:

    1) The division is alot weaker and the Pats are prime for a drop off. If we can split with NE I think we can at least garner a wild card spot. Miami and the Jets will still be very bad this year.

    2) I think the O-line will continue to improve and hopefully we will have some healthy depth to help out.

    3) The Bills have to get some WR help. I believe that we will still bring in a veteran when all is said and done.

    4) Fred Jackson is a key to this offense. I actually believe that he will be on the field with Lynch at the same time this year. The guy has talent and he will be an integral part of the offense. I will get a ton of flack over this one but I really believe this.

    5) MOMENTUM!!!!!!!!!!!! This is a young team that had alot of injuries last year. This team believes that it can win. We have to win games early. Once this team has a 3-1 or 4-2 record I believe they will play above there talent. When was the last time the Bills had a winning record after 6 or 7 games???

    Re: How I think the Bills make the playoffs!

    i think the biggest two keys to the offensive success are the tight end and throwing the ball to lynch.

    we heard all this bull**** last year about how sweet lynch's hands were and he flashed it plenty, but 18 catches? are you serious? if i was the head coach, i would tell Turk that if Lynch didn't catch 50-60 passes this year, he was going to get fired.

    the tight end is also huge. Trent clearly loves throwing the underneath stuff and dump offs when the heat is coming. He is very good at it.. so he needs as many weapons as he can get that will allow that type of game to be productive..

    they are also clearly going to use a 3 step drops more, which will emphasize this even more.

    so with lynch (and jackson) used correctly in the passing game, and an actual tight end that is even remotely above average, i think the offense will look tons better. we need to see 125 to 150 catches between lynch, jackson, and the TE position this season. if we do, the offense wont be the reason we miss the playoffs. thats for sure.
